Question
In the following figure r1 and r2 are 5 cm and 30 cm respectively. If the moment of inertia of the wheel is 5100 kg-m2 then its angular acceleration will be : -


Options
A.10-4 rad/sec2
B.10-3 rad/sec2
C.10-2 rad/sec2
D.10-1 rad/sec2
Solution
Angular acceleration 
τ = (10 + 9) × 0.3 - 12 × 0.05 = 5100 α
∴ α = 10-3 rad/sec2
